Methylamphetamine (commonly referred to as methamphetamine) is a member of a broad class of psycho-stimulant compounds called amphetamines. Amphetamines act on the central and peripheral nervous system. In this document, 鈥榓mphetamine鈥� is abbreviated as 鈥楢MP鈥� and methylamphetamine is abbreviated as 鈥楳A鈥�.
